- This video outlines the long stay visitor visa. Did you know you can apply for a visitor visa that is granted for up to 3 years in duration and allow you to stay up to 12 months each period? This visa is perfect for someone who has family in Australia and wants to spend a longer period than just 3 months on the standard e- visitor visa.

Visa Stream:
Long Stay Visitor Visa (Tourist Stream) - Subclass 600
Duration:
Up up to 3 years. The visa will also be multiple entry (meaning the visa holder can enter and exit Australia as much as he wants during this period)
Length of stay in Australia:
On this visa, the visa holder would be allowed to remain in Australia for 12 months in an 18
month period. Meaning if you spend 12 months in Aus, you must remain outside of Australia
for the remaining 6 months.
Cost:
The visa cost $145
